APPOINTMENT OF -PPP- COUNCIL GOOD FOR 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T

By Michael Kaluba

The Kitwe and District Chamber Of Commerce and Industry says the appointment of the public-private partnership-PPP- council of ministers is welcome as long as it adds value to the country’s economic development.

Chamber Vice President in-charge of commerce Emmanuel Mbambiko says while it is important for government to appoint as many great minds to various councils, boards and other relevant bodies, these appointments must be done objectively and to add value to the country’s economic recovery.

Mr. Mbambiko tells Phoenix News that these must come with more benefits to the country than the cost especially that the national coffers are reportedly empty, the economy limping and the country needing every resource to get back on track.

He adds that the government must ensure it assesses the cost against the benefits before making any appointments and that all the appointments work in tandem with the economic recovery plan to the benefit of citizens.

President Hakainde Hichilema recently has appointed the Public-Private Partnerships Council of Ministers which includes minister of Finance, minister of Infrastructure, Commerce, Trade and Industry minister, Transport and Logistics minister and minister of Technology and science with 4 other none cabinet members appointments.
